1. Embracing Technology for Enhanced Learning
One of the most significant trends in the Math Refresher for Everyday Problems is the integration of technology. Platforms like Khan Academy, Coursera, and edX now offer interactive courses that incorporate advanced algorithms and artificial intelligence to personalize learning experiences. These technologies adapt to the learner’s pace and style, ensuring that each student receives the support they need. For instance, adaptive learning systems can identify knowledge gaps and provide targeted exercises, making the learning process more efficient and effective.
2. Focus on Real-World Applications
Another major innovation in this field is the emphasis on real-world applications. Gone are the days when math courses were purely theoretical. Today, the curriculum is designed to address practical scenarios faced in everyday life. For example, courses now cover topics like financial management, data analysis, and statistical literacy. These skills are not only useful for personal finance but also for making informed decisions in various professional contexts. By learning how to apply mathematical concepts to real-world problems, students can gain a deeper understanding of the subject and see its relevance in their daily lives.
3. Collaboration and Peer Learning
Collaboration and peer learning are becoming increasingly important in the Math Refresher courses. Many platforms now encourage students to work together on projects and discuss problems with each other. This fosters a sense of community and allows students to learn from different perspectives. Peer learning can enhance problem-solving skills by exposing students to diverse approaches and strategies. Additionally, collaborative projects often require the use of technology, which can help students develop digital literacy skills alongside their mathematical skills.
